3-Day Adventure Itinerary in Delhi for June 2023

  1. Day 1: Adventure at Indian Mountaineering Foundation, South Delhi
    20 minutes (6.3 miles) from Indira Gandhi International Airport

    In the morning, head to the Indian Mountaineering Foundation to try your hand at rock climbing and rappelling. The professional instructors will guide you through the process and ensure your safety. In the afternoon, you can go for a trek in the Aravalli hills or indulge in some indoor activities like wall climbing. In the evening, enjoy a bonfire and barbecue with your fellow adventurers.

  2. Day 2: Wildlife Safari at Asola Bhatti Wildlife Sanctuary, South Delhi
    35 minutes (11 miles) from Indian Mountaineering Foundation

    Start your day early and head to Asola Bhatti Wildlife Sanctuary for a thrilling wildlife safari. The sanctuary is home to several species of animals and birds like the Indian leopard, blackbuck, and crested serpent eagle. In the afternoon, visit the Tughlaqabad Fort, an ancient monument with a fascinating history. In the evening, relax and unwind at the serene Surajkund Lake.
